##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 2.6:1 — AA fail, AA-large fail,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#697d0c (4.63:1); AA: background → #383838 (4.51:1); AAA: text → #4d5d09 (7.28:1); AAA: background → #141414 (7.09:1)
- On black (#000000): 8.08: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A pass
